Thats not true, Google Fi has the same priority as postpaid T-Mobile. This is something MVNOs negotiate in their contracts with carriers, not something thats true across the board. Discount MVNOs increase their margins by buying wholesale deprioritized data while Google Fi has negotiated the no deprioritization.

Is this talked about somewhere? All I see is this reddit post[0] by u/Peterfield53, which looks like a very active user on r/GoogleFi but doesn't seem to be a Googler or otherwise a Google Fi support agent. 0: https://old.reddit.com/r/GoogleFi/comments/ulc1t5/perks_of_f...

https://old.reddit.com/r/NoContract/comments/oaophe/data_pri...

>QCI 6 is applied to all of T-Mobile's postpaid and prepaid plans (except for Essentials) and Google Fi which also has QCI 6 as well. This means if you want the absolute best from T-Mobile, you want to get a plan directly from them. Even their cheap $10 prepaid 1GB Connect plan has priority data.

You can apparently confirm this with a rooted phone: https://coveragecritic.com/2019/09/17/how-to-find-qci-values...

>My Google Fi service had a QCI of 6 during regular data use.

Early in the pandemic, I spent a while without wired internet using a wireless hotspot from the library which would not connect to Netflix but any other streaming video service was fine. I forget who the wireless vendor behind the hotspot was—I think it might have been Verizon.

So there's a bit of a weird fact about public libraries, which is that it probably wasn't on the normal internet (Internet1) but was in fact on Internet2 (see [1]).

Internet2 is used by hospitals, among other things, and as such has higher robustness requirements than Internet1. The pandemic created much higher demand for bandwidth from hospitals, forcing Internet2 providers to scramble to keep up in areas. As such, blocking high-bandwidth sites which are clearly lower priority than medical traffic might have actually been a reasonable move.

I considered switching APNs, but didn't want to run afoul of any AT&T rules. I went ahead and gave it a try anyway, switching from `broadband` to `NXTGENPHONE`. I wasn't able to authenticate with `NXTGENPHONE`, so I switched it back to `broadband`. After re-authenticating, I'm no longer being throttled. I'm both happy and deeply dissatisfied with this outcome because I think now I'm less likely to get to the bottom o…

You're welcome. This just reminded me of the IT Crowd... Have you tried turning it off and on again.

By disconnecting / reconnecting by trying the APN switch, it might've just put you on a different P-GW that has a different traffic shaping configuration or current state.
